Extracting information from emails to populate in Request fields


I suspect I know the answer here BUT... Is it possible to parse text from an incoming email for use in the creation of a request?

We would like to set the customer based on information contained in the email summary. Process would be as follows:

1. Email received with something like "Leaving user  114356" in the subject. Where the number is their company employee number.

2. Find user in Hornbill by number provided. (this is stored in a custom field)

3. From this user record lookup their manager.

4. Set manager as the owner of the request being created.


Any guidance much appreciated. 

